O race race 1:09:00 [4] 4.63 km (14:54 / km) +186m 12:25 / km

Day 2 of the NSW State League event - Roseberg South map - DNF - spur gully (with limited rock detail mapped I subsequently discovered). Not confident wth the map after the first leg which I did ok but saw a flag on a termite mound and not sure where that was. Absolutely made a great parallel error on the longish leg to 2 - ended up 300 metres from 2 and about 7 contours higher - slope in the same direction and multiple unmapped rocks meant after a frustrating search I trudged back and never really relocated until a few hundred metres from the finish. Only worked out where I was by looking at the master map for control 53 which I found a couple of times while being lost. At least some exercise.
